Output 7bde33d1a4faa80fa8eb11ca129904ffbb860bb9912106eeb0824d13f4bfe79e:11

value
45493892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71a101873517fe94c1f749eae1be88722446c2ea OP_EQUAL
address
3C3qA7RD4PJnMETomSmcaXtnVP9zLy6uQA
transaction
7bde33d1a4faa80fa8eb11ca129904ffbb860bb9912106eeb0824d13f4bfe79e
spent
true